Chicago Auto Show Tease: Kia e-AWD Concept


Kia has released a teaser for their upcoming concept car that will be shown at Chicago. The concept will feature an electric all-wheel drive system and be aimed at "city dwellers seeking the ultimate urban escape." From what we can tell from the teaser shot, it looks like a Soul with a few more inches of ground clearance and body cladding.

We'll have more information and live shots from Chicago Auto Show in a couple of weeks.

KIA MOTORS AMERICA TO REVEAL CONCEPT AT CHICAGO AUTO SHOW

Kia Motors America will unveil an advanced and capable electric all-wheel drive (e-AWD) concept vehicle at the upcoming Chicago Auto Show. This bold off-roader was conceived by Kia’s California design studio and built for city dwellers seeking the ultimate urban escape. Intended to enable a wide array of outdoor activities from skiing and snowboarding, to camping, hiking and mountain biking, this rugged runabout captures the essence of adventuring at higher elevations with the promise of surefootedness in the wild.

Kia’s newest concept will be revealed on the Kia stand Thursday, February 12 at 9 AM.
